Contribution Workflow

We're excited about your interest in contributing to Alphanome AI's projects! To ensure a smooth and efficient process for all contributors, we've established this workflow. Please follow these steps to contribute effectively and avoid overlapping efforts.

Step 1: Select a Task

  1. Option A: Explore Open Issues:

    • Check out our Request For Contributions board for tasks that are ready for contributions.
    • Alternatively, browse through the GitHub Issues page of a specific project, such as sec-parser Issues or sec-ai Issues.
    • Tips:
      • Look for tasks labeled contributions-welcome. These tasks align with the project goals.
      • If you're new to the project, look for tasks labeled good-first-issue.
      • Be sure to check if a task is already tagged in-progress to avoid duplicate efforts.
  2. Option B: Propose a New Task:

    • Go through our Short-Term Roadmap to understand our focus areas and upcoming projects.
    • If you discover an issue or have a novel idea, feel free to propose it. Initiate a conversation either in the Discussions forum or on our Discord server.

Step 2: Prepare for Contribution

  1. Read CONTRIBUTING.md:

    • Before you begin, read the CONTRIBUTING.md file of the project for guidelines on setup, coding standards, and codebase understanding.
  2. Fork the Project:

    • Fork the project on GitHub to create your own workspace.
  3. Communicate Your Plan:

    • We recommend commenting on the issue you're tackling to discuss your approach and seek guidance. This also allows us to tag the issue as in-progress.
  4. Continuously Sync Your Fork:

    • Follow this GitHub Guide to synchronize your fork with the main repository.

Step 3: Begin Your Contribution

  1. Submit a Pull Request:

    • Create a pull request with your changes, clearly explaining your contributions.
  2. Check for Errors:

    • Run our automated checks and your local tests to catch and fix any issues before final submission.

We're grateful for your contributions and look forward to your valuable input in our project!

Seeking Assistance and Asking Questions

If you have any questions, or concerns, or need further clarification, feel free to reach out. Please use our Discussions page for more detailed queries and Discord for quick, conversational questions. For questions specific to a GitHub issue or pull request, kindly post them directly in the respective issue or PR thread.
